Where to Recycle Christmas Trees

Lost Mountain Park is one of several Cobb locations accepting the trees through Jan. 7.

Cobb residents are encouraged to help the environment by recycling their Christmas trees, which are used for mulch, fuel, wildlife habitats and other useful material. Keep Cobb Beautiful is sponsoring the free recycling drop-offs.
